Output 18134a0846234fc6d0e5cbc59711ba1757d7cbb881203a9a5262d9342466110c:42

value
2705238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b1a30a96f07039eb9f2a01a898e6488519d4c14 OP_EQUALVERIFY OP_CHECKSIG
address
1CDuVKDt5AmqvAteJqMFDtW4HEuBMdo19A
transaction
18134a0846234fc6d0e5cbc59711ba1757d7cbb881203a9a5262d9342466110c
spent
true